Matt Peirce, a current intern and resident go-to guy for any international news, wrote about the current turmoil in South Africa.
Recent headlines about South Africa have not been very encouraging. Stories about violence, xenophobia, and army involvement have probably left many Americans feeling at the very least a bit concerned about South Africa as a nation. I just want to assure everyone that we here at Thrive Africa are quite safe. Living on a remote game reserve three hours from major cities does have its advantages. The violence is fairly contained to poor township areas around Johannesburg and is rooted in complicated issues of poverty and immigration. It’s not as if the general consensus in South Africa is a hatred of foreigners. As a matter of fact, I was just in Qwa Qwa the other day and it was as safe and calm as it always is. I plan to return next week without any fear or apprehension. South Africa needs prayer (as does every country) but it is by no means falling into anarchy.
